Brownstones that breathe again

Manhattan's brownstones age with dignity till overlook, moisture, or bad renovations catch up. A good Brownstone restoration designer Manhattan understands structure anatomy. Joists may be sistered, yet you need to take a look at why they drooped. That garden-level moisture could be a flat sidewalk pitch, an absent leader, or a long-ago oil tank elimination. The company has actually peeled off back greater than a few floorings to find enthusiastic 1980s cutouts that require steel, old wood with powder message beetle trails, or stonework that wants lime mortar, not Rose city cement.

In one West 80s townhouse, an earlier engineer had carved a double-height gallery into the back bay, which looked significant but developed rough temperature swings and strange noise bounce. Baobab rebuilt a tipped mezzanine that recovered room-to-room affection while maintaining a thoughtful vertical link. They embeded a hidden fabric acoustical layer and a very discreet ducted system, so the new area checks out calm as opposed to spacious. The family members stops there each early morning. That is the mark of areas that draw people in.

On one more job in Harlem, a yard leasing had a ceiling hardly removing seven feet. Decreasing the slab would have caused a tangle of waterproofing and foundations. Rather, the team pressed daylight from above with a bigger staircase opening, glass risers, and a skylight sized just timid of what Landmarks would certainly enable. They redeemed the feeling of elevation without excavating a toe into the aquifer. For clients looking for Residential architect new york experience focused on brownstones, these are the trade-offs that matter: invest money on light and air, not on dealing with a trouble you can stay clear of with far better planning.

Bathrooms are where waterproofing either functions or it doesn't. A normal detail package could include pre-slope layouts, aesthetic shifts, and exact placement of shower specific niches to strike ceramic tile component joints. These are not glamorous choices, yet they are the kind that make a job really feel calm five years later. The firm tracks which cement and sealers perform in time in New York water problems. Sustainability in a city that punishes waste

New York is thick sufficient that power usage folds up into next-door neighbor comfort and code restraints. The firm favors passive methods initially. Positioning and home window selection to manage heat gain, constant insulation to eliminate thermal bridges, and air sealing that hits numbers a blower door can verify. Where mechanical systems issue, they steer clients toward heat pumps sized by tons calculation, not hopeful reasoning. They fit with ERVs in limited envelopes and have actually integrated glowing floorings where it makes sense rather than as a reflex. In condominiums with tall stacks, they tame pile impact with compartmentalization and mindful vestibule design.

Materials come under examination also. The workplace maintains a running log of suppliers with qualified EPDs and stays clear of greenwashing. They do not oversell net-zero desires to homes that travel for job and host a lots people every weekend break. However they will certainly show you just how to set you back out induction with appropriate electrical planning, exactly how to keep a gas line for a backup grill if you must, and exactly how to future-proof a panel for an EV battery charger in a garage you show to 3 other owners. Pragmatism lives beside ambition, not in opposition to it.

A few functional takeaways if you are intending a project

    Decide rapidly whether you are focusing on routine, budget plan, or extent, after that adhere to that hierarchy. You can strike 2 strongly, the third will flex. Ask your designer to reveal one or two constructed instances of an information you respect the majority of. Pictures and a phone call with a past customer are worth a loads renderings. Confirm building and co-op guidelines before style gets too much. Venting, acoustic underlay, and wet-over-dry limitations can improve a plan. Order long-lead items early, especially windows and plumbing fixtures. The calendar is as real a constraint as the whole lot line. Hold a coating example in your hand and pour water, oil, or coffee on it if that will certainly be its destiny. Upkeep is not theoretical.
